Android深度探索第三章感想

在第三章中,整一章主要介绍了一个东西,就是Git。

Git是一个用于管理源代码的软件,在Linux中的软件有很多都不直接以二进制形式的安装包提供,而是直接提供了源代码。用户需要先下载源代码,然后在本机上编译并且安装(一般使用make、make install等命令)。所以,我们在进行驱动开发的过程中也会经常性的下载各种不同的源代码进行修改、编译,所以一款使用便捷的源代码管理软件是必不可少的。

在很多Linux系统中都已经自带了Git,没有自带的时候可以自行安装。

安装所需的命令是# apt-get install git        #apt-get install git-doc git-svn git-emall get-gui gitk

使用Git管理文件(Git不仅仅是管理源代码的工具,实际上它还管理任何的文件),首先要将文件提交到本地版本库(.git目录)。

Git 仓库就是那个.git 目录,其中存放的是我们所提交的文档索引内容,Git 可基于文档索引内容对其所管理的文档进行内容追踪,从而实现文档的版本控制。.git目录位于工作目录内。
1) 工作目录:用户本地的目录;
2) Index(索引):将工作目录下所有文件(包含子目录)生成快照,存放到一个临时的存储区域,Git 称该区域为索引。
3) 仓库:将索引通过commit命令提交至仓库中,每一次提交都意味着版本在进行一次更新。

总之,对于Git的使用对我来说还是刚刚熟悉,很多东西都不很清楚。

posted @ 2016-05-03 17:41  浅愿芊荨  阅读(97)  评论(0编辑  收藏  举报